

JAY PAUL DIRKS On Monday, August 27, 2012, Jay Paul Dirks of Winnipeg, MB was taken home to be with the Lord after a six-month fight with cancer, at Bethesda Hospital in Steinbach, at the age of 29. Jay was born in Steinbach on July 25, 1983. He spent his summers growing up at Red Rock Bible Camp and continued on as staff. Jay was most known for his voice. He belonged to various choirs including: Eastman Youth Choir, Prairie Voices, Providence College, National Youth Chorus, University of Manitoba, Gilbert and Sullivan and many more. Jay attended the University of Manitoba and was to finish his second degree in Education this year. Jay will be remembered always and missed dearly. He is survived by his lovely wife Melissa Gayle Dirks (Yorke), parents Cliff and Iris Dirks, grandparents Malinda Dirks, Walter and Margret Reimer, his sister Robin Dirks Pay, her husband Erick and their children Kian and Keira, his brother Wren Dirks and his wife Renata Dirks and their daughter Sophia. Uncles, aunts, cousins, and many close friends were blessed by Jay touching their lives.
